On Thursday, 16 December 1999 at 19:33:01 -0700, Kenneth D. Merry wrote: > On Thu, Dec 16, 1999 at 17:18:45 -0800, Greg Lehey wrote: >> grog 1999/12/16 17:18:45 PST >> >> Modified files: >> contrib/sendmail/mail.local pathnames.h >> Log: >> Change location of temporary file from /tmp to /var/tmp. This is a >> repeat of an earlier commit which apparently got lost with the last >> import. It helps solve the frequently reported problem >> >> pid 4032 (mail.local), uid 0 on /: file system full >> >> (though there appears to be a lot of space) caused by idiots sending >> 30 MB mail messages. >> >> Most-recently-reported-by: jahanur <jahanur@jjsoft.com> >> >> Add $FreeBSD$ so that I can check the file back in. > > I don't mean to start another babbling war on -committers, but wouldn't > this break POLA, since most applications set TMPDIR to /tmp by default? Possibly. There are other alternatives; I personally wonder why we need a temporary file at all. I was just re-applying a change which had been made a couple of years ago.
